Price is in US dollars and excludes tax and handling fees
Alocasia odora, Giant elephant ear, green textured leaf, nature and plants background
super macro of a green leaf of a plant showing the leaf veins
Heart-shaped Daphne Blossoms
The plant alocasia is Okinawa